1. Real Infrastructure, Not Just a Fancy Dock

Here's the thing: a proper marine services provider doesn't just exist on paper or a LinkedIn page full of stock images. They’ve got the hard stuff—dry docks, fabrication yards, specialised workshops, and actual people who aren’t Googling how to fix a propeller mid-job.

The UAE is home to some significant players in this field. We're talking marine service providers in UAE who operate industrial-level facilities across key locations like Dubai Maritime City, Sharjah’s Hamriyah Free Zone, and Abu Dhabi’s Mussafah.

It’s not about size for the sake of size. It’s about having the right tools in the right place. You want someone who doesn’t need to ship parts from halfway across the globe to patch a job that should’ve been sorted yesterday.

3. End-to-End Project Management (AKA No Excuses)

A true maritime partner doesn’t drop the ball halfway. They handle the whole game: from design consultation to engineering, testing, certifications, and delivery.

Want a real-world example? Let’s say you're outfitting a commercial tug. A subpar provider will get you a hull and engine, sure, but you’ll be stuck juggling ten other vendors for navigation systems, fire safety, load-line certification, etc.

Meanwhile, elite ship manufacturing companies in UAE bring all of it under one roof. That means fewer delays, no blame-passing, and a single team responsible for the outcome.

You’re not chasing updates across departments. You’re just getting things done, with weekly progress reports, 3D model reviews, and post-launch testing included. That’s the difference between good and exceptional.


4. Compliance Is Not Optional (and the Best Make It Easy)

Regulatory compliance in marine operations is a minefield. International standards. Local port authorities. Environmental guidelines. If your partner isn’t on top of all this, you’re setting yourself up for fines, delays, or worse—detention at port.

The top marine service providers in UAE don’t just follow regulations. They help you get ahead of them.

We're talking proactive documentation, in-house surveyors, coordination with classification societies, and automatic flag-state updates. Some even offer remote compliance monitoring through onboard IoT integration.

You shouldn’t have to be the one asking, “Are we ISM compliant?” The right partner has already ticked that box and sent you the paperwork.
